免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

vs生成的exe和dll在哪里

Visual Studio(VS)是一款微软开发的集成开发环境(Integrated Development Environment,IDE),用于开发计算机程序、网站、网络服务和手机应用程序。VS支持多种编程语言,其中包括C、C++、C#等。当你使用Visual Studio创建并编译一个项目时,会生成可执行的.exe或库.dll文件。在这里,我们将详细介绍这两种文件,以及它们在Visual Studio中的位置。

1. 可执行文件(.exe)

可执行文件是包含为计算机处理器设计的机器代码的文件。它们可以在Windows操作系统上直接执行。当你在Visual Studio中开发并编译一个应用程序项目时,它将生成一个与之关联的可执行文件。

生成的exe文件默认存储位置:

在Visual Studio中,exe文件通常位于项目文件夹的以下位置:

`<项目目录>\bin\<配置名>`

其中,`<项目目录>`是您的项目文件的存储路径,`<配置名>`是当前构建配置,例如:Debug或Release。因此,如果您正在使用Debug配置,您可能默认在以下位置找到exe文件:

`<项目目录>\bin\Debug`

2. 动态链接库文件(.dll)

动态链接库(DLL,Dynamic Link Library)是包含可被多个程序共享的代码和数据的库。DLL文件可以被视为一种模块化方法,使得多个程序可以共享同一功能,从而减少需要磁盘空间和内存。

生成的dll文件默认存储位置:

当您在Visual Studio中创建并编译一个动态链接库项目时,它将生成一个.dll文件。默认情况下,dll文件位于项目文件夹的以下位置:

`<项目目录>\bin\<配置名>`

与exe文件一样,`<项目目录>`表示项目文件的存储路径,`<配置名>`表示当前构建配置(例如:Debug或Release)。因此,对于Debug构建配置,您通常会在以下位置找到生成的dll文件:

`<项目目录>\bin\Debug`

3. 如何找到生成的文件(.exe和.dll):

要快速访问Visual Studio中生成的exe或dll文件,您可以:

a. 在“解决方案资源管理器”窗口中右键单击项目。

b. 在弹出菜单中选择“打开文件夹位置”,这将打开包含项目文件的文件夹。

c. 接着打开“bin”文件夹,然后根据当前构建配置打开对应的子文件夹(如Debug或Release)。

d. 在这个文件夹中,您可以找到生成的.exe或.dll文件。

简而言之,Visual Studio在项目的bin文件夹下为各种配置分别生成.exe和.dll文件。这些文件可在Windows操作系统上直接执行或由其他程序引用。


相关知识:
制作图标exel
Excel是一款非常实用的电子表格软件,除了日常的数据处理和数据分析功能外,还可以用来制作图标。在Excel中,我们可以使用图标来直观地展示和比较数据,更容易地理解和分析数据。本文将详细介绍如何在Excel中制作图标,以及制作图标的原理。一、Excel中制
2023-06-14
vs2022生成exe文件
Visual Studio 2022是一个功能强大的集成开发环境(IDE),适用于Windows操作系统。它通常用于编写、编译、调试和发布程序代码。本文将详细介绍如何使用Visual Studio 2022生成exe可执行文件(传统Windows应用程序)
2023-06-14
vc exe 打包
在本文中,我们将讨论 VC++ EXE 打包的原理与详细介绍,包括如何使用 Visual C++ 构建可执行文件(EXE 文件)以及使用静态库和动态库。VC++ EXE 打包允许您将程序与其依赖项捆绑在一起,从而提供更好的跨平台兼容性。下面来详细了解有关
2023-06-14
qt调用exe打包
在这篇文章中,我们将了解如何在Qt应用程序中调用外部可执行文件(exe),并且我们将讨论如何将外部exe文件打包到你的Qt应用程序中。这对于那些想要在Qt应用程序中使用已有的可执行文件的开发者非常有用。**Qt调用外部exe文件**在Qt中,我们可以通过使
2023-06-14
qt编的exe怎么打包
在这篇文章中,我们将了解如何将用Qt编写的应用程序打包成单个可执行文件(.exe),以便在没有Qt环境的计算机上运行。我们将使用Windows操作系统为例。打包的过程分为以下几个步骤:1. 确保安装了Qt SDK和MinGW编译器。首先,您需要在您的计算机
2023-06-14
python tk界面生成exe
Python Tkinter是一个很好的GUI库,用于为Python应用程序创建图形界面。使用Tkinter库,我们可以在Python应用程序中创建自定义窗口和控件。然后我们可能需要将Python代码(有Tkinter代码的Python脚本)打包为单独的可
2023-06-14